PEER_GRAPH_EVENT_TYPE 枚举 (p2p.h)

PEER_GRAPH_EVENT_TYPE枚举指定要通知应用程序的对等事件类型。

语法

typedef enum peer_graph_event_type_tag {
  PEER_GRAPH_EVENT_STATUS_CHANGED = 1,
  PEER_GRAPH_EVENT_PROPERTY_CHANGED = 2,
  PEER_GRAPH_EVENT_RECORD_CHANGED = 3,
  PEER_GRAPH_EVENT_DIRECT_CONNECTION = 4,
  PEER_GRAPH_EVENT_NEIGHBOR_CONNECTION = 5,
  PEER_GRAPH_EVENT_INCOMING_DATA = 6,
  PEER_GRAPH_EVENT_CONNECTION_REQUIRED = 7,
  PEER_GRAPH_EVENT_NODE_CHANGED = 8,
  PEER_GRAPH_EVENT_SYNCHRONIZED = 9
} PEER_GRAPH_EVENT_TYPE;

常量

 
PEER_GRAPH_EVENT_STATUS_CHANGED
值:1
对等图状态已以某种方式更改。 例如,节点已与对等图同步。
PEER_GRAPH_EVENT_PROPERTY_CHANGED
值: 2
对等图属性结构中的字段已更改。 此对等事件不会为应用程序生成要检索的特定数据片段。 应用程序必须使用 PeerGraphGetProperties 来获取更新的结构。
PEER_GRAPH_EVENT_RECORD_CHANGED
值: 3
记录类型或特定记录已以某种方式更改。
PEER_GRAPH_EVENT_DIRECT_CONNECTION
值: 4
对等方的直接连接已更改。
PEER_GRAPH_EVENT_NEIGHBOR_CONNECTION
值: 5
与对等邻居的连接已更改。
PEER_GRAPH_EVENT_INCOMING_DATA
值: 6
已从直接连接或邻居连接接收数据。
PEER_GRAPH_EVENT_CONNECTION_REQUIRED
值: 7
对等图已变得不稳定。 客户端应在新节点上调用 PeerGraphConnect 。 此对等事件不会为应用程序生成要检索的特定数据片段。
PEER_GRAPH_EVENT_NODE_CHANGED
值: 8
节点的状态在对等图中已更改。
PEER_GRAPH_EVENT_SYNCHRONIZED
值: 9
特定记录类型已同步。

要求

要求
最低受支持的客户端 具有 SP2 的 Windows XP [仅限桌面应用],具有 SP1 的 Windows XP 与高级网络包 forWindows XP
最低受支持的服务器 无受支持的版本
标头 p2p.h

另请参阅

PEER_GRAPH_EVENT_DATA

PEER_GRAPH_EVENT_REGISTRATION

PeerGraphConnect

PeerGraphGetProperties